Save a Private Key as an Encrypted PKCS #8 PEM File

Demonstrates the Chilkat PrivateKey.SavePkcs8EncryptedPemFile method, which saves the key as password-protected PKCS #8 PEM (the ENCRYPTED PRIVATE KEY label). The first argument is the password and the second is the destination path.
Note: The file paths are relative to the application's current working directory. Absolute paths may also be used. Supply the paths appropriate to your own environment.
Background: The text (PEM) form of an encrypted saved key — portable across systems and safe to store because the private material is protected by a passphrase. It is the encrypted counterpart to

import sys
import chilkat2
success = False
# Load a private key to export.
privKey = chilkat2.PrivateKey()
success = privKey.LoadPemFile("qa_data/private.pem")
if (success == False):
print(privKey.LastErrorText)
sys.exit()
# The key password is not hard-coded in a real application; obtain it from an interactive
# prompt, environment variable, or a secrets vault.
password = "myKeyPassword"
# Save as password-protected PKCS #8 PEM (the "ENCRYPTED PRIVATE KEY" label). The 1st argument
# is the password and the 2nd is the destination path.
success = privKey.SavePkcs8EncryptedPemFile(password,"qa_output/private_pkcs8_enc.pem")
if (success == False):
print(privKey.LastErrorText)
sys.exit()
print("Saved (encrypted).")
